Registry modifications (*Modify at your own Risk*)

Caution: Editing your registry may cause your system to fail to start; modify at your own risk!

Only trained computer professionals should modify the system registry. These modifications are only recommended with systems having 128 MB of RAM or greater.

The following registry modifications refer to Windows* 2000 or Windows XP. If the key does not exist, it is possible to simply add the key and set the value accordingly.

Edit the following registry key:
H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Control\Session Manager\MemoryManagement\

DisablePagingExecutive
Set to 1 to increase paging of the NT Executive to RAM instead of to the page file

IOPageLockLimit
Default setting is 0, which is equivalent to 512KB. Experiment by increasing this setting in 1024KB increments until you max out your performance gains. A good benchmarking program will show when the limit has been reached. For some systems, 8192KB (8MB) and higher may result in performance gains.

LargeSystemCache
Set to 1 to improve disk caching performance
